Deanna Wong content with gradual return to playing minutes with Choco Mucho

Choco Mucho Flying Titans setter Deanna Wong is delighted to gradually regain her playing time after being sidelined with an injury at the beginning of the PVL 1st All-Filipino Conference.

The former Ateneo de Manila University Blue Eagles playmaker received the starting position for the Flying Titans during their 25-15, 25-16, and 25-21 sweep of the Capital1 Solar Energy Solar Spikers on Saturday. She concluded the match with nine excellent sets and two points.

“Masaya na nakapaglaro na pero unti-unti pa rin. It’s more of the system talaga that we follow, kaya kahit sino naman ipasok, nagagawa pa rin namin ‘yung kailangang gawin,” said Wong.

“Siyempre alam naman nila coach kung paano ‘yung gagawin during game or kung anuman pong strategy na ginagawa. Lagi namang sinasabi nila coach na health-wise talaga ‘yung mas mahalaga,” she added.

The Cebuana setter further said that she is happy to be able to adjust to her new teammates in the Flying Titans with the help of head coach Dante Alinsunurin.

“Siguro po, it starts sa training naman lalo na sina coach at saka ‘yung teammates ko, nandiyan naman sila. It’s more of how we help each other kasi and how we bring up each other, and dahil naman sa kanila ‘yun,” Wong said.

The Flying Titans are currently in first place in the standings with a 7-1 win-loss record.
